Two OpenAI models managed to escape from a closed test environment, connect to the open internet and sneak into the Hugging Face platform, in what the company itself has described as an “unprecedented” cybersecurity incident. The story sounds almost like science fiction, but it happened just a few days ago and is already generating a global debate about how prepared we are to control increasingly autonomous systems.

Who are the protagonists of this escape?

The agent responsible for this mess was powered by a combination of two models, GPT-5.6 Sol, the most recent public version of OpenAI, along with another even more powerful model that is still in the pre-release phase and does not even have an official name. Both were being evaluated in an isolated environment, known as a sandbox, designed to measure the extent of their offensive cybersecurity capabilities.

The curious thing is that, according to OpenAI, the evaluation was done without several of the mechanisms that normally stop models from executing high-risk actions, precisely because the objective was to see how far they could go.

How they managed to escape and reach Hugging Face

The process was a rather ingenious chain of decisions on the part of the system. The models discovered and exploited a zero-day vulnerability in a server that functioned as a proxy to install software packages.

This allowed them to escalate privileges and move within the environment until they found a node with access to the Internet. Once there, they deduced on their own that Hugging Face might have models, data sets, or clues related to the test they were solving, something called ExploitGym.

So they chained together new techniques, including the use of stolen credentials, until they were able to execute code remotely on the servers of that platform. All this without human intervention and, according to OpenAI itself, without any malicious intention behind it; the system was just trying to “cheat” to better pass the evaluation to which it was being subjected.

Why did OpenAI run these types of tests?

These types of exercises exist because AI companies need to know, before anyone else finds out, what the real ceiling of the offensive capabilities of their models is in the world of cybersecurity. It sounds counterintuitive, but to build solid defenses you must first understand the attacks that a model could orchestrate if it fell into the wrong hands or if it was simply given enough autonomy. The problem here was that, by disabling certain restrictions to measure that maximum limit, the isolation from the environment itself became insufficient and the agent ended up operating outside the expected limits.

Hugging Face, for its part, detected the intrusion the week before the announcement and managed to contain the attack before it escalated into something more serious. Both companies are now collaborating on the forensic investigation of the incident, and OpenAI has already responsibly notified the affected software vendor of the vulnerability, in addition to strengthening security controls in its own research environments. The company also announced that it will implement new monitoring measures for future evaluations, just the type of tests that led to this whole episode.

What this case leaves on the table is an uncomfortable reminder: The more capable AI models become, the more creative they also are in finding ways out that their own creators did not anticipate. And although on this occasion there was no real harm or malicious intent, the fact that a system managed to bypass restrictions specifically designed to contain it raises serious questions about how these technologies are going to be evaluated going forward.
